Hey business community, thanks for joining in the fun. We need you to sign up so we can stay in touch with you, send you game graphics and communicate weekly game cards. Here's a Q&A that might help:
If I sign up and someone gets COVID, will I have to shut down?
No. Your registration is not contact tracing. We just need to contact you with details, posters, etc. The reason this is an outdoor activity is that COVID makes so many things unpredictable, keeping it outdoors helps us keep it going.
Do I have to register in the window dressing contest to participate?
No. It seems like a good idea to link the events, but you don't have to register with the contest to put an elk in the window.
Do I create my own masked elk to put in the window?
No. We'll create all the graphics for you. We just need you to sign up and let us know what holiday advice YOUR elk is going to say. We'll send you the completed graphics next week with more instructions.
You mentioned a game card. I don't see one on the scavenger hunt web page.
We haven't created the first game card yet. We're waiting to see how many companies and how many prizes we have before we create the first game card, which we will post the Wednesday before Thanksgiving.
Can players just turn their game card into the Chamber?
Yes. The reason we're using Google pages it to make this a contact free event. The Chamber is not receiving visitors because of the darned pandemic, but we'll put a game card envelope outside our door.
Do I have to have a downtown business to play?
No. The game is intended to send visitors and shoppers all over town. We have created zones to get folks up Moraine and out St. Vrain, all the way around the lake and into Stanley Village. Our goal is to drive traffic to your door. Even though they can gather their game card info through your window display, YOU have a great opportunity to lure them in with a freebie, BOGO or special.
Do I have to have a storefront to play?
No. This is open to everybody, even lodging. If you don't have a window display, we can post your elk on your website.
Is this just for kids?
Depends on how young at heart you are. You can see from the array of prizes at esteschamber.org/scavenger-hunt that this is not just for kids. Our aim is to get shoppers in your store.
Can I promote this on my web site or social media?
Yes. The success of this game is to get the word out to all our friends and visitors. We will supply you with lots of memes and videos to post or share directly from the Shop Estes Facebook page.
How many prizes are given out every week?
We're running this for four weeks. Depending on how many prizes are donated, there might be 4-5 prizes issued each week. Entries will be categorized by the number of zones they hit. The more zones they visit, the higher the prize they qualify for.
Is this perfect?
No. It's an attempt to create some fun that will sustain any level of pandemic chaos. Use the drive by traffic to let folks know what you have to offer. If we move to Orange or Red COVID levels, direct them to shop online. Let's band together to shop local.
